Admiral Taverns invests over ยฃ27m into community pubs
Admiral Taverns has announced that it invested over ยฃ27m to improve its community pubs in 2023. The group, which owns approximately 1,500 pubs across England, Scotland and Wales, has invested the funds into over 300 pubs across both its leased and tenanted estate and its community wet-led division, Proper Pubs.…

Farmer J to receive ยฃ5.5m funding to further growth
Farmer J has announced a ยฃ5.5m fundraise, led by Beringea, the transatlantic venture capital firm, to power further growth for the brand, with five new sites planned for 2024.
